About Kestle
Kestle and Kestle Mill are small hamlets located in Cornwall, England, just south of Quintrell Downs. Kestle Mill lies along the A3058 main road and predominantly falls within the civil parish of St. Newlyn East, making it a relevant area for planning applications related to local development and infrastructure.
